Output 1159b89dbccebc6c5d4953b3ea820d2698e92a74814f87af8bf47e61aaff01ce:21

value
100498486
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 620badad39c6186115cd7ca0c8bde79f54aa280d OP_EQUALVERIFY OP_CHECKSIG
address
19wRDENXmzmaqMBx1vKSMCqtrGTo31oPSt
transaction
1159b89dbccebc6c5d4953b3ea820d2698e92a74814f87af8bf47e61aaff01ce
confirmations
289668
spent
true